@font-face{font-family:Geist Thin;font-weight:100;font-style:normal;src:url(/assets/fonts/Geist/Geist-Thin.ttf)}@font-face{font-family:Geist ExtraLight;font-weight:200;font-style:normal;src:url(/assets/fonts/Geist/Geist-ExtraLight.ttf)}@font-face{font-family:Geist Light;font-weight:300;font-style:normal;src:url(/assets/fonts/Geist/Geist-Light.ttf)}@font-face{font-family:Geist Regular;font-weight:400;font-style:normal;src:url(/assets/fonts/Geist/Geist-Regular.ttf)}@font-face{font-family:Geist Medium;font-weight:500;font-style:normal;src:url(/assets/fonts/Geist/Geist-Medium.ttf)}@font-face{font-family:Geist SemiBold;font-weight:600;font-style:normal;src:url(/assets/fonts/Geist/Geist-SemiBold.ttf)}@font-face{font-family:Geist Bold;font-weight:700;font-style:normal;src:url(/assets/fonts/Geist/Geist-Bold.ttf)}@font-face{font-family:Geist ExtraBold;font-weight:800;font-style:normal;src:url(/assets/fonts/Geist/Geist-ExtraBold.ttf)}@font-face{font-family:Geist Black;font-weight:900;font-style:normal;src:url(/assets/fonts/Geist/Geist-Black.ttf)}@font-face{font-family:Geist Mono Thin;font-weight:100;font-style:normal;src:url(/assets/fonts/GeistMono/GeistMono-Thin.ttf)}@font-face{font-family:Geist Mono ExtraLight;font-weight:200;font-style:normal;src:url(/assets/fonts/GeistMono/GeistMono-ExtraLight.ttf)}@font-face{font-family:Geist Mono Light;font-weight:300;font-style:normal;src:url(/assets/fonts/GeistMono/GeistMono-Light.ttf)}@font-face{font-family:Geist Mono Regular;font-weight:400;font-style:normal;src:url(/assets/fonts/GeistMono/GeistMono-Regular.ttf)}@font-face{font-family:Geist Mono Medium;font-weight:500;font-style:normal;src:url(/assets/fonts/GeistMono/GeistMono-Medium.ttf)}@font-face{font-family:Geist Mono SemiBold;font-weight:600;font-style:normal;src:url(/assets/fonts/GeistMono/GeistMono-SemiBold.ttf)}@font-face{font-family:Geist Mono Bold;font-weight:700;font-style:normal;src:url(/assets/fonts/GeistMono/GeistMono-Bold.ttf)}@font-face{font-family:Geist Mono ExtraBold;font-weight:800;font-style:normal;src:url(/assets/fonts/GeistMono/GeistMono-ExtraBold.ttf)}@font-face{font-family:Geist Mono Black;font-weight:900;font-style:normal;src:url(/assets/fonts/GeistMono/GeistMono-Black.ttf)}html{background-color:#333}*{margin:0;padding:0;box-sizing:border-box;line-height:100%;font-family:Geist Medium,sans-serif}a,button,input,textarea{all:unset}button{cursor:pointer}button:disabled{cursor:not-allowed}